20 dicas para criar páginas da Web com o Dreamweaver
Autor:Eve Cole
Data da Última Atualização:2009-06-01 01:02:13
1) Como integrar o Dreamweaver ao navegador IE?
O programa de instalação do Dreamweaver adicionará um comando “Editar com Dreamweaver” ao menu de contexto. Também podemos modificar o registro do Windows para integrá-lo ao IE. Assim como o MS Word, Frontpage e Notepad, o Dreamweaver é chamado para abrir a página da web atual através do botão de edição na barra de ferramentas do IE.
Altere a última linha do texto a seguir para o seu próprio caminho de instalação do Dreamweaver, salve-o como um arquivo *.reg e clique duas vezes nele para adicionar as informações ao registro.
REGEDIT4
[HKEY_CLASSES_ROOT.htmOpenWithListDreamweaver]
[HKEY_CLASSES_ROOT.htmOpenWithListDreamweavershell]
[HKEY_CLASSES_ROOT.htmOpenWithListDreamweavershelledit]
[HKEY_CLASSES_ROOT.htmOpenWithListDreamweavershelleditcommand]
@="C:Arquivos de programasMacromediaDreamweaver 3dreamweaver.exe %1"
Se você deseja defini-lo como o editor padrão do IE, abra as "Opções da Internet" do IE e especifique-o na guia Programa.
2) Para utilizar determinados scripts, muitas vezes é necessário adicionar links vazios a gráficos ou texto. Porém, ao clicar em um objeto com link vazio durante a navegação, ele irá para o topo da página. esse?
Porque o navegador pensa que o link é para a mesma página, mas não consegue encontrar o marcador definido (âncora), então ele permanece no topo da página. Substitua o " # " dos links vazios por " javascript:void(null) " para resolver este problema.
3) Ao usar CSS e camadas, os efeitos em diferentes navegadores são diferentes e às vezes ocorre até desalinhamento.
Em termos de compatibilidade com diferentes navegadores, o Dreamweaver faz um bom trabalho, mas isso não significa que as páginas da web criadas com o Dreamweaver serão exatamente iguais no IE e no Netscape. Em circunstâncias normais, a aparência da mesma página navegada por diferentes navegadores não pode ser exatamente a mesma. Isto é determinado pelos navegadores de diferentes fabricantes.
Geralmente, tente prestar atenção às seguintes questões:
Não misture o layout da camada e da tabela. Se houver um relacionamento pai-filho, como uma tabela em uma camada, isso não está dentro do escopo deste princípio;
CSS inline geralmente causa problemas no Netscape Navigator, use encadeamento ou inline;
Às vezes é necessário inserir tabelas ou imagens transparentes em uma camada vazia para garantir o efeito no Netscape Navigator. Para camadas com apenas alguns pixels de largura ou altura, use imagens;
Evite usar propriedades tipográficas que não sejam recomendadas pela organização W3C e, em vez disso, use CSS.
4) Por que ao copiar texto de outros documentos para o Dreamweaver, todos os parágrafos ficam amontoados e há códigos de formatação dentro do Dreamweaver?
Existem duas categorias de copiar e colar texto no Dreamweaver. A forma padrão copia o objeto junto com suas propriedades e usa o conteúdo da área de transferência como código HTML; a outra forma apenas copia ou cola o texto, ignorando o formato html ao copiar e colar; colando. Em seguida, cole o código HTML como texto. Pressione mais uma tecla “Shift” (Ctrl+Shift+C/Ctrl+Shift+V) para operar desta última maneira.
5) Por que a página web pode ser navegada normalmente usando o IE, mas não atende aos requisitos ou até comete erros ao usar o Netscape Navigator, e por que não pode ser bem modificada na janela do documento do Dreamweaver?
Por favor, verifique o código. Como você usa o editor WYSIWYG para modificar repetidamente certas partes da página, às vezes algum código redundante será deixado, como links redundantes. Esses códigos não podem ser vistos na janela do documento do Dreamweaver e o IE os ignorará. No entanto, o Netscape Navigator possui requisitos de código mais rígidos e fenômenos incríveis ocorrem durante a visualização.
6) No Netscape Navigator alguns marcadores (âncoras) não funcionam e alguns parecem ter desaparecido?
Os marcadores do Netscape Navigator diferenciam maiúsculas de minúsculas. No Navigator, os marcadores em tabelas aninhadas de múltiplas camadas serão perdidos.
7) A janela do documento do Dreamweaver está repleta de vários painéis. Para editar o documento, tenho que abrir cada lacuna.
Uma tela com resolução de 800X600 é realmente pequena demais para o Dreamweaver, mas mesmo 1024X768 não cabe em todos os painéis. O segredo é estar bem organizado.
Feche os painéis que não são usados temporariamente na edição e junte os painéis comumente usados para economizar espaço na tela;
A menos que você precise usá-lo agora, feche o “HTML Source Inspector”. Além de ocupar espaço na tela, ele também ocupa recursos consideráveis do sistema;
Pressione F4 para ocultar todos os painéis abertos e ver o documento inteiro, e pressione novamente para exibir os painéis;
Existe um comando “Organizar paletas flutuantes” no menu “Windows”. Use este comando para colocar todos os painéis abertos ao redor da janela sem se sobreporem.
Usar teclas de atalho com frequência e dominá-las com proficiência é uma boa maneira de melhorar a eficiência do trabalho.
Ao adicionar objetos invisíveis, o Dreamweaver adicionará o ícone correspondente na parte superior da página na janela do documento. Se houver muitos ícones, isso poderá dificultar a edição. Você pode ocultá-los e exibi-los pressionando "Ctrl+Shift+I" (menu principal Exibir|Elementos invisíveis). Você também pode configurar esses ícones para não aparecerem, mas isso não é recomendado porque eles ajudam a selecionar objetos para edição.
8) O painel do objeto Head só pode adicionar conteúdo. O conteúdo da tag <head> pode ser modificado na janela do documento?
Pode. Existe uma maneira muito intuitiva, pressione "Ctrl+Shift+W" (menu principal Exibir | Conteúdo do cabeçalho), uma linha de ícones aparecerá sob a barra de menu principal da janela do documento, clique nesses ícones para modificar.
9) Como selecionar imagens muito pequenas em tabelas e camadas, como 1X1px?
Clique em uma célula da tabela, mantenha pressionada a tecla “Shift” e mova com as teclas de seta para selecionar.
Você também pode selecionar a célula da tabela (pressione a tecla Ctrl e clique na célula correspondente com o mouse) ou camada primeiro e, em seguida, selecione <img src="..."> no código destacado no painel "HTML Source Inspector" para retornar à janela do documento e a imagem será selecionada.
10) Como editar o nome (Título) de um sistema framework?
Pressione "Ctrl+F10" para abrir o painel "Molduras", clique no quadro mais externo e pressione "Ctrl+J" (menu principal Modificar | Propriedades da página).
11) Como alterar o evento padrão de “comportamentos”?
O arquivo de configuração do evento é colocado na pasta "ConfigurationBehaviorsEvents" no diretório de instalação do Dreamweaver. Por exemplo, para navegadores da versão 4.0 ou superior, abra o arquivo "4.0 and Later Browsers.htm".
<A onClick="*" onDblClick="" onKeyDown="" onKeyPress="" onKeyUp="" onMouseDown="" onMouseOut="" onMouseOver="" onMouseUp="">
Mova o "*" em " onClick="*" " para " onMouseOver="" " e altere para: < A onClick="" onDblClick="" onKeyDown="" onKeyPress="" onKeyUp="" onMouseDown= " " onMouseOut="" onMouseOver="*" onMouseUp="">
Reinicie o Dreamweaver, o evento padrão deste tipo se torna "onMouseOver". Outras analogias.
12) Ao abrir uma página, uma pequena janela pode ser aberta ao mesmo tempo usando o Dreamweaver?
Sim, sem escrever uma única linha de código. Use o script integrado "Abrir janela do navegador" no painel "comportamentos" para definir a página, o tamanho da janela e as propriedades. Como mostrado na imagem:
13) Ao inserir uma tabela, sempre há um espaço (< td> < /td>) na célula da tabela. Como posso evitar que isso aconteça?
Isso é gerado automaticamente pelo Dreamweaver, não o exclua. Se não houver nada numa célula da tabela, o Netscape Navigator não exibirá a célula.
14) A tag <head> de um documento modelo não pode ser editada, exceto para o tema da página web. Como posso adicionar comportamentos a uma página web baseada neste modelo?
Use o painel "Inspetor de origem HTML" para adicionar uma tag editável antes do "</head>" do documento modelo, como segue:
< !-- #BeginEditable "Javascript" -->
<linguagem script="JavaScript">
</script>
< !-- #EndEditable -->
15) Ao cooperar para desenvolver e gerenciar um site, utilizando o sistema de registro/inspeção do Dreamweaver, são adicionadas diferentes permissões de acesso aos arquivos relacionados ao site no servidor remoto?
Check in/check out é um mecanismo de gerenciamento usado internamente pelo Dreamweaver e não tem nada a ver com atributos de arquivo. "check out" significa que o arquivo está sendo usado por mim e outras pessoas não podem editá-lo; "check in" significa que o arquivo pode ser retirado e editado por outros colegas, e o arquivo local se tornará somente leitura para me impedir de fazer check-out e editá-lo por outros colegas. alterando-o.
O Dreamweaver implementa a função de check in/check out gerando arquivos ".lck" correspondentes em servidores locais e remotos. Esses arquivos não são exibidos na janela "Site". Nenhum atributo é adicionado ao arquivo. Se você usar outras ferramentas e editores de FTP, ainda poderá abri-los.
16) Ao criar uma página web, o mouse fica voando, muitas vezes alterando o tamanho das imagens definidas. Isso pode ser corrigido sem revisar a imagem?
Se o tamanho da imagem não corresponder, seu valor ficará em negrito no painel de propriedades. Pressione o botão “Atualizar” no painel para restaurá-lo ao seu tamanho real.
17) Como posso clicar em um link e alterar vários frames ao mesmo tempo?
A maneira mais direta é criar um sistema de quadros para o link.
É mais fácil usar o comportamento "Ir para URL" do Dreamweaver. A caixa de diálogo exibe todos os frames. Basta preencher a página correspondente na coluna "URL" abaixo.
18) Quero adicionar comportamento ao texto, mas os itens no painel de comportamento estão todos escuros e não selecionáveis. O que devo fazer?
Ao me deparar com essa situação antes, geralmente insiro uma imagem ao lado do texto e adiciono o comportamento necessário à imagem. Em seguida, edite o código, mova-o sobre o texto e remova a imagem.
O método acima é mais complicado. A maneira conveniente é vincular o texto a "javascript:void(null)" e esses comportamentos serão revelados honestamente.
19) Ao colocar uma camada usando comportamentos na Biblioteca, o Dreamweaver não permite que os comportamentos da camada sigam. O que devo fazer?
Use modelos.
20) O script que verifica o plug-in Flash e redireciona às vezes é anormal. Existe algum outro método?
Ao criar páginas da web em Flash, as pessoas estão acostumadas a usar o comportamento de "plug-in de verificação" do Dreamweaver para redirecionamento. Mas às vezes ele informa incorretamente, dizendo que o plug-in está obviamente instalado, mas diz que não. Esta é uma maneira sólida de redirecionar.
Crie uma nova página inicial como página de redirecionamento. Use "Insert Refresh" no painel de objetos "head" para direcionar para uma página da web que não usa tecnologia Flash, conforme mostrado na figura. Ele adicionará o seguinte código ao cabeçalho da página: < meta http-equiv="refresh" content="4;URL=noflash.htm">
Faça outro pequeno vídeo em Flash e adicione um comportamento "Obter URL" no primeiro quadro para apontar para uma página usando a tecnologia Flash. Incorpore este pequeno vídeo em sua página inicial para fins de segmentação.
Obviamente, esta página redirecionada é muito confiável.